Transaction d2efda59114931cb387b42dcd7680b74722b4b2ea1d64befd5369ebc4c057610
1 Input
2 Outputs
- d2efda59114931cb387b42dcd7680b74722b4b2ea1d64befd5369ebc4c057610:0
- d2efda59114931cb387b42dcd7680b74722b4b2ea1d64befd5369ebc4c057610:1
value 1000000
address 1wSfPS8sUaxPy4EekGniuw3YSPfEija7m
value 37830065
address 1MarHMUWGYQ8nVPAxDxTRrsKzUjJsui4HV